Title: The Innovations of Nicolas Rojo Saiz
Introduction
Nicolas Rojo Saiz is a prominent inventor based in Navarra, Spain, known for his contributions to renewable energy technology. With a total of five patents to his name, he has made significant strides in the field of wind energy.
Latest Patents
One of his latest innovations is a wind turbine blade designed with a generally hollow blade body that includes half shells and webs. Each web features flanges, with the first and second webs being supported by respective reinforcement structures. These structures are strategically arranged between the outer and inner layers of the upper and lower half shells, extending in the lengthwise direction of the blade. The reinforcement structures consist of stacks made from several pultruded composite strips that include carbon fibers, fixed in resin. Additionally, a stiffening element, composed of glass fiber layers infused with resin, is arranged between the reinforcement structures. Another notable patent is for a rotor blade of a wind turbine, which includes a first rotor blade segment and a second rotor blade segment connected by a joint. This rotor blade also features a fairing that covers the joint and is attached to both shell portions using adhesive.
Career Highlights
Nicolas Rojo Saiz is currently employed at Siemens Gamesa Renewable Energy Innovation & Technology S.L., where he continues to develop innovative solutions in the renewable energy sector. His work focuses on enhancing the efficiency and performance of wind turbine technology.
